Operational Status — Indicates whether the port is currently
■
operational or non-operational.
Admin Speed — Displays the configured rate for the port. The port
■
type determines what speed setting options are available. Port speeds
can only be configured when auto negotiation is disabled. The
possible field values are:
10M — Indicates the port is currently operating at 10 Mbps.
■
100M — Indicates the port is currently operating at 100 Mbps.
■
1000M — Indicates the port is currently operating at 1000 Mbps.
■
Current Port Speed — Displays the current configured port speed.
■
Admin Duplex — Displays the port duplex mode. This field is
■
configurable only when auto negotiation is disabled, and the port
speed is set to 10M or 100M. This field cannot be configured on
LAGs. The possible field values are:
Full — The interface supports transmission between the device and
■
its link partner in both directions simultaneously.
Half — The interface supports transmission between the device
■
and the client in only one direction at a time.
Current Duplex Mode — Displays the current port duplex mode.
■
Auto Negotiation — Displays the auto negotiation status on the
■
port. Auto negotiation is a protocol between two link partners that
enables a port to advertise its transmission rate, duplex mode, and
flow control abilities to its partner.
Current Auto Negotiation — Displays the current auto negotiation
■
status on the port.
Admin Advertisement — Defines the auto negotiation setting the
■
port advertises. The possible field values are:
Max Capability — Indicates that all port speeds and duplex mode
■
settings are accepted.
10 Half — Indicates that the port advertises for a 10 Mbps speed
■
port and half duplex mode setting.
10 Full — Indicates that the port advertises for a 10 Mbps speed
■
port and full duplex mode setting.
100 Half — Indicates that the port advertises for a 100 Mbps speed
■
port and half duplex mode setting.
